Job Description

We are seeking a dynamic and experienced Senior Associate to join our Communications team at KPMG. As a leading professional services firm, we are dedicated to delivering exceptional client service and developing innovative solutions. The Senior Associate, Communications will play a crucial role in shaping and executing our external and internal communication strategies. We are looking for a talented individual with a strong background in communications, excellent writing skills, and the ability to work in a fast-paced and collaborative environment. Join us and be a part of our driven and diverse team, where you will have the opportunity to make a significant impact on our firm's reputation and growth.

  1. Develop and execute external and internal communication strategies to enhance the firm's reputation and support its growth.
  2. Write and edit a variety of communications materials, including press releases, articles, blog posts, social media content, and internal communications.
  3. Collaborate with cross-functional teams to ensure consistent messaging and alignment with overall business objectives.
  4. Monitor media coverage and industry trends to identify potential communication opportunities and risks.
  5. Act as a spokesperson for the firm and effectively communicate key messages to external stakeholders.
  6. Build and maintain relationships with media outlets, industry influencers, and other key stakeholders.
  7. Plan and execute events, such as press conferences and media interviews, to promote the firm's brand and thought leadership.
  8. Provide strategic communications counsel to senior leaders and support them in delivering effective and engaging presentations.
  9. Manage and coordinate crisis communications, including drafting statements and managing media inquiries.
  10. Stay up-to-date with emerging communication tools and technologies and make recommendations for their integration into communication strategies.
  11. Mentor and provide guidance to junior team members to develop their skills and contribute to the team's success.
  12. Collaborate with external agencies and vendors to support the execution of communication initiatives.
  13. Monitor and report on the effectiveness of communication strategies and make recommendations for improvements.

About KPMG

KPMG International Cooperative is a multinational professional services network, and one of the Big Four accounting organizations. Seated in Amstelveen, the Netherlands, KPMG is a network of firms in 154 countries, with 207,050 people and has three lines of services: financial audit, tax, and advisory.
